High temperature sintering furnace | High temperature mesh belt sintering furnace In the realm of industrial manufacturing, the demand for high temperature sintering furnaces has been steadily increasing. These advanced furnaces play a crucial role in the production of various materials, ranging from ceramics and metals to powders and electronic components. Among the different types of sintering furnaces available, the high temperature mesh belt sintering furnace stands out for its efficiency and versatility. High temperature sintering furnaces are designed to operate at temperatures above 1000°C, making them ideal for processes that require extreme heat. These furnaces utilize advanced heating elements and insulation materials to create a controlled atmosphere conducive to the sintering process. The high temperature mesh belt sintering furnace, in particular, offers the added advantage of a continuous conveyor belt system, allowing for the efficient processing of large quantities of materials. One of the key benefits of using a high temperature sintering furnace is the ability to achieve uniform sintering results. The precise temperature control and even distribution of heat within the furnace ensure that the materials undergo consistent sintering, leading to high-quality end products. This level of control is essential for industries such as aerospace, automotive, and electronics, where the performance and reliability of materials are paramount.
